1355 Category Manager
Duties:
We are seeking a skilled and proactive Category Manager to oversee the review and negotiation of Statements of Work (SOWs) under (USD)100K.
This role is critical to ensure that SOW terms align with Legal’s annotated clause guidance and sourcing policies.
The successful candidate will serve as a key point of contact for stakeholders and suppliers, managing approximately 2,400 SOWs annually.
The Category Manager will work closely with cross-functional teams to negotiate terms, drive compliance, and deliver value to the organization.
Key Responsibilities:
SOW Review and Negotiation:
Review and negotiate SOWs in accordance with Legal’s annotated clause guidance.
Ensure compliance with the company’s sourcing policies, including competitive bidding and preferred supplier utilization.
Identify and mitigate risks within contract terms and conditions.
Stakeholder Collaboration:
Partner with internal stakeholders to understand project scopes and requirements.
Provide consultation on SOW structuring to align with organizational objectives.
Supplier Engagement:
Act as the primary liaison with suppliers during SOW negotiations.
Resolve disputes and align on favorable terms.
Process Management and Reporting:
Manage a streamlined review process to handle high volumes efficiently.
Maintain detailed records of negotiations and final agreements.
Track metrics related to SOW turnaround times and compliance, contributing to KPI dashboards.
